Latest development version (v21.6.22b) has this change (trash icon, final column)
However, it's probably easier, now, to examine the cache from the device Variables pages, since the plotting option allows you to select the cache as well as any of the archives – it's easier to find the variable there too, rather than on the fairly lengthy cache page.
